2 angles that are complementary. One angle is 4 degrees less than three times the other angle. Find the measures of the angles.

Complementary angles add to 90o

the other angle = x
the first angle = 3x - 4

x + 3x - 4 = 90
4x - 4 = 90
4x = 94
x = 94/4
x = 23.5

the first angle = 3*23.5 - 4 = 66.5

Solve the equation for x.
liq [111]

Answer:

x=55

Step-by-step explanation:

The given equation is \sqrt{x-6}+3=10

Group similar terms to get:

\sqrt{x-6}=10-3

\sqrt{x-6}=7

Square both sides to obtain:

x-6=7^2

x-6=49

Add 6 to both sides

x=49+6

Simplify the right hand side to obtain;

x=55
